Centreville A.C.

Centreville Athletic Club of Bayonne, New Jersey was a U.S. soccer team which competed in the National Association Football League, winning two championships.

In April 1895, the Centreville A.C. joined the newly establish National Association Football League (NAFBL), a professional soccer league encompassing northern New Jersey and New York City.

[1] The team had been in existence previously as a recreational club.

However, the records for the league's second season have not been fully reconstructed and the final standings are unknown.

The onset of a major recession combined with the Spanish–American War led to a suspension of the league in 1899.
